Candidates will be able to raise objections against the provisional JEE Main answer key online. For every objection, the candidates will have to pay INR 200. The fee payment has to be done online i.e., through credit card/debit card/net banking. If the candidates do not pay the required fee then their objections will not be accepted. Along with the fee, the candidates will also have to submit the supporting proof for the objections.
In case the JEE Main answer key challenge raised by the candidate is accepted, the NTA will send an email to the registered email address mentioning the details of question for which the objections has been accepted. The NTA will also send the details of correct answer for the questions.
Objections raising fee in JEE Main answer key is INR 200 per question. You can pay it online using internet banking or credit/debit card. The exact fees to be paid depends on total questions selected for grievance.

JEE Main 2022 Marking Scheme
Candidates can refer to the official marking scheme of JEE Main March 2021 mentioned below:
Marking Scheme for MCQs: Candidates will be allotted 4 marks for each correct answer and there will be a deduction of 1 Mark for every incorrect answer.
Marking Scheme for Numerical Answer Type (NAT) questions: Candidates will be allotted 4 marks for each correct answer and there will be no negative marking for such questions.
